I love watching horror films, but won’t act in them – Lavanya Tripathi
Published on Oct 22, 2017 3:25 pm IST

Energic Star Ram’s upcoming romantic entertainer, Vunnadi Okate Zindagi, is scheduled for October 27th release. On this occasion, we caught up with Lavanya Tripathi, who is playing one of the female leads in the film, for a detailed interview. Here is the transcript:

Q) Tell us about your role in the film?

A) I’m playing an ambitious, smart girl who has a bundle of energy. This role is very similar to my real life character.

Q) You did many love stories earlier, what difference did you notice in this film?

A) This film will be very realistic. Today’s youths will easily relate themselves to the characters in the film.

Q) What is your personal opinion on Zindagi (Life)?

A) I do not take life too seriously and try to enjoy every moment of it.

Q) Tell us about your character’s duration in the film?

A) I should not reveal it at this moment (laughs). Usually, more than the character’s duration, I look at its importance in the film. For example, in the recently released Raju Gari Gadhi 2, Samantha’s role is very limited in terms of its screentime, but her character and acting stood as the backbone of the film.

Q) Can we expect a lady-oriented film from you?

A) Why not. I love to do women-centric roles, but we should have a perfect script and a good director to handle the project.

Q) Would you like to act in a horror film?

A) I love watching horror films as it’s my favorite genre, but I won’t act in those films. At the same time, I skip watching love stories, but interestingly, most of my films are love stories.

Q) Coming back to VOZ, tell us about the working experience with Ram?

A) I’m a huge fan of Ram’s work. He is a good actor and working with him was a very good experience.

Q) Tell us about your future projects?

A) This year, I already had four releases. Currently, I’m listening to various scripts and I will let you know when I finalize something.
